Born in Norristown, PA, Hugh moved to Florida at a young age. He is one of three children and was raised by his mom in Jacksonville, FL. Growing up he enjoyed hunting, fishing, riding jet skis, hanging out at the beach, and playing football. Hugh is an Industrial Safety Trainer for Publix and celebrates Black History Month every February.
“To me, Black History Month is a condensed version of the great achievements, contributions, and resilience of Black People throughout history. I personally celebrate by shopping locally at black-owned businesses and acknowledging those before me. Both my grandfather and my wife's ancestors were involved in pivotal moments of African American history”
During Black History Month, Hugh and his wife cook a mixture of traditional Haitian and African American dishes to honor them.
